Stayed Apr 2, 2022Had stayed at this property last year and came back because of the location and walkability to the town. This year everything was good except our room was on the end of the unit next to the Hyatt property. The Hyatt used the lot next to our building to drop an empty Dumpster at 5 am and then proceed to drop stuff and garbage in it for the next two nights and days. After that every 18 wheeler and delivery truck backed in with their reverse horns beeping every morning before sunrise. These delivery trucks woke us every morning before sunrise!! The other downfall was that they wouldn’t let us check in until after 6 pm but insisted we checked out by 10 am. The pros of the unit were, for sure, the air conditioning unit, the kitchen, bathrooms and the washer and dryer. The beds were just average but acceptable. The pool and tiki/bar hut on premises were very nice. You can’t beat the sunsets at this location. All in all, I would probably stay again, but just not on the side by the Hyatt.

Stayed Aug 21, 2021This property is a hidden gem in all of Old Town Key West! This particular room has an incredible view of the small private beach (perfectly large enough to enjoy for all ages, even with 3 children ages 8, 6 & 4), the Gulf of Mexico and the pool. It's located right on the marina where the water adventures & fishing trips load in and out of. There are lots of restaurants surrounding the marina as well! Also, The Galleon is only a 2 min walk to Duval Street and a 2 min walk to Mallory Square!! Additionally, basically right on the same property, you can rent a golf cart and sightsee for the day or keep it for a week! My kids (and my hubby and I too) loved riding all over Key West on the 6-seater golf cart! Our stay was Aug 21 to Aug 28 and we felt like we had the town to ourselves. We'll definitely be staying at the Galleon on future trips to Key West and we'll be sure to visit at this time of year!!

Stayed Mar 10, 2018We found this unit on VRBO and were pleased and impressed. The view from our unit was great overlooking the water and the pool. We were on the 4th floor of a five floor building. The unit was well appointed with cable and high speed internet. Although, we found the internet to be slow and sometimes couldn’t stream Netflix. The complex is located in a great part of key West. It’s right next to a large marina and very close to the action on Duval Street. This was our first time to Key West and we would definitely go back. The restaurants are great with a lot of variety. We took a restaurant walking tour which I would recommend. You get a good feel for the Cuban influence on the community and we ate some great food. Next time we will try to fly directly in to Key West rather than Fort Lauderdale. The drive was very long and we found that once in Key West we walked everywhere and didn’t use the rental car.
